Founded in 2009, IdentityIQ is an identity theft protection and credit monitoring company. They offer comprehensive product bundles that include identity theft protection, credit reporting & scores, and credit monitoring. The company is BBB accredited and carries an A+ grade.

The $1 sounds good but "DON'T FALL FOR THE FREE LUNCH" There is always a string attached.... I signed up with company in around end of August for the $1 and checked it out , when you call to cancel or pause in which I WAS going to resign up early 2020 , but instead when you call to cancel they give you a additional unmotivated sales script. After you say no to that, then they get a bit iggy and when you ask for a refund you are told you will be BLACKLISTED and not able to use the service again. This is basically a "TIME SHARE SALES PITCH mixed with Car Dealership sales tactic's with no real care about your credit or business. smh Thanks a lot for.... nothing

Irony...a credit protection agency charged my credit card without my authorization. I had lost my debit card that was associated with my IdentityIQ monitoring service. I received an email from them on March 10th that we were not able to charge my credit card and asked me to update my profile, which I elected not to do with my new debit card number. Today, April 11th, I was charged twice for $14.95 on my new card which I never gave them the account number. I called the company to request a refund and to ask how they got my new debit card number and I was told that my bank gave it to them (which is not the case, I verified with my bank). This company is a complete RIP-OFF. DO NOT DO BUSINESS WITH THEM. They lock you into recurring payments. Then cannot backdate cancellations. You have to call back when it's about to expire, or you will be charged another month. If you choose to cancel immediately, you are still charged but will not be able to use the services for the rest of the month.
